Osnove SQL-a za analizu podataka - besplatni tečaj od Skypro-a, obuka 2 mjeseca, datum 29.11.2023.
Miscelanea / / December 02, 2023
Razvit ćete svoje podatkovne vještine i napraviti prvi korak u traženom zanimanju.
Naučit ćete kako sami analizirati podatke i moći ćete donositi točnije i učinkovitije odluke.
Naučite izvlačiti informacije iz baza podataka i dubinski analizirati ponašanje korisnika.
Naučite nijanse rada s bazama podataka i pomozite tvrtkama u donošenju učinkovitih odluka na temelju podataka.
Naučit ćete kako unaprijediti web stranicu ili aplikaciju kroz kompetentan rad s bazama podataka.
Sudjelujete u webinarima, 60-minutnim video lekcijama uživo i dovršavate zadatak nakon svake lekcije. Lekcije se mogu pregledati u bilo koje prikladno vrijeme.
Od početka tečaja rješavat ćete probleme bliske radnim zadacima analitičara u popularnom tumaču Jupyter Notebook. Ovo je pravo razvojno okruženje koje možete koristiti za vlastite radne zadatke.
Analizirate stvarne probleme na timskim majstorskim tečajevima pod vodstvom stručnjaka. Podijelite svoje iskustvo, primite podršku i korisne veze u profesionalnom okruženju.
Autor i predavač tečaja SQL
Vodeći analitičar proizvoda u Skyeng.
Razvio sustav za borbu protiv lažnih transakcija u ukrajinskoj Alfa-Bank. Zajedno sa španjolskim kolegama savjetovao je velike 4 banke: analizirao milijune transakcija i predložio rješenja za uštedu milijuna dolara. Analizirani i prognozirani ključni poslovni pokazatelji za Skyeng top management.
Analitičar proizvoda u tvrtki Skyeng. Mentor za tečaj. 2,5 godine u analitici i 2,5 godine u SQL-u.
Zajedno s timom lansirao je vrhunski proizvod i pomogao ubrzati odabir nastavnika u Skyeng-u. Poboljšan je algoritam za prepoznavanje hotelskih rezervacija visa na Ostrovok.ru. Smanjene pogreške tipa II za 69%. „Pomoći ću analitičaru početniku da brzo savlada SQL i postane veliki stručnjak. SQL je za analitičara kao zrak za osobu. Olakšava kopanje po podacima, traženje uvida, testiranje hipoteza i davanje preporuka tvrtki.”
Inženjer podataka u tvrtki Skyeng. Autor i nositelj kolegija. Koristi SQL u radu više od 8 godina.
Radi u timu podatkovnih inženjera u tvrtki Skyeng. Razvijeno izvješćivanje za TOP-10 banku. Bio je MS SQL programer u jednoj od vodećih tvrtki za automatizaciju mobilne trgovine u CIS-u. Radio s AWS Redshift, Microsoft SQL Server, Oracle, PostgreSQL, MySQL, DB2 i drugim bazama podataka.
Modul 1
Rad s izvornim podacima
Osnovni upiti
Naučite odabrati i filtrirati podatke pomoću naredbi SELECT, FROM, WHERE. Naučite sortirati podatke i koristiti uvjete.
Domaća zadaća
Generiranje novih značajki i čišćenje podataka
Razumjet ćete kako raditi s naredbom CASE. Naučite kako stvoriti nove značajke i filtrirati prema njima.
Domaća zadaća: pripremiti uzorak podataka za obuku modela preporuke za online trgovinu.
Testni rad za modul: upload podataka za odjel marketinga pod određenim uvjetima.
Modul 2
Pretvorba podataka
Agregatne funkcije
Naučite agregirati podatke, grupirati ih po poljima, pronaći zbroj, pronaći minimum, maksimum, broj jedinstvenih elemenata i prosjek.
Domaća zadaća
Spajanje tablica
Naučit ćete kako kombinirati tablice, proučiti metode i moći odabrati onu pravu za svoj zadatak.
Domaća zadaća
Podupiti i WITH
Shvatite kako napraviti ugniježđene upite i stvoriti privremene tablice za pohranjivanje posrednih podataka. Savladajte konstrukcije WITH i naučite kako ih koristiti za pisanje složenih upita.
Domaća zadaća
Funkcije prozora
Naučite funkcije OVER, LAG, LEAD, RANK, ROW_NUMBER. Naučite izračunati pokazatelje za različite skupine objekata: odstupanje od prosjeka za skupinu iu cjelini, serijski broj transakcija kupaca, pomični prosjek.
Domaća zadaća
Master class: provođenje analitičkog istraživanja i rješavanje poslovnog problema pomoću SQL-a
Bit ćete uronjeni u zadatak analitičara podataka iz stvarnog života i pomoći ćete tvrtki riješiti problem. Pod vodstvom mentora analizirat ćete podatke iz različitih tablica, prvo ih očistiti i kreirati nove značajke.
Domaća zadaća
Modul 3
Osnove administracije baze podataka
Kreiranje, mijenjanje, brisanje podataka u tablici. Izrada indeksa. Privremeni stolovi
Naučite kreirati, mijenjati, brisati podatke u tablicama i same tablice pomoću naredbi CREATE, UPDATE, INSERT, DELETE, DROP.
Razumjet ćete kako izraditi privremene tablice i koristiti ih u upitima.
Domaća zadaća
Osnove optimizacije
Usustavite svoje znanje pisanja upita.
Naučite kako pisati upite i kako odabrati metodu za zadatak.
Domaća zadaća
Tečajni rad
Analitički projekt u SQL-u
Edukativni projekt
Projekt za analizu metrike kvalitete sadržaja i ishoda učenja učenika na mrežnom skupu podataka škole za 2021.
Vaš vlastiti projekt
Odaberite sami.